POUGHKEEPSIE – Dutchess County Executive Marcus Molinaro has asked Governor Cuomo to provide COVID-19 vaccine supplies for individuals with intellectual and development disabilities. The county executive said reduction in allotments due to the state prioritizing supplying its own mass vaccination sites are “deeply troubling.”

Molinaro asked Cuomo to prioritize vaccinating that at-risk population by “ensuring group homes and congregate care facilities that serve individ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ities have access to the vaccine; providing flexibility and supplying doses to counties with the capacity to vaccine this population is critical; and clarifying the definition of ‘congregate care site’ to ensure it included certified day programs.”

The county executive said individuals with intellectual and development disabilities, “especially those who live in group homes or in congregate care settings, face an immense risk from COVID-19.” He said those facilities “continue to suffer from the ravages of this pandemic as the greatest protections we have are not always practical for many of these individuals, as some struggle to understand social distancing and have difficulty wearing masks.”

Molinaro said many residents of those facilities “have gone without critical services or received a lower standard of service due to safety constraints, which are necessary in many cases, yet still damaging.” He said technology has allowed many people to acclimate to social distancing, “mitigating to an extent the damage done by this pandemic. However, for many individuals with intellectual and development disabilities, technology is a poor substitute for in-person services and supports.”

He said access to a vaccine “is a means to not only protect this population and those that serve them, but also ensure high-quality care and services can be provided safely.”
